In the realm of personal development and self-improvement, the concept of holding ground is pivotal. It refers to the ability to maintain one’s position, beliefs, or values in the face of adversity or challenges. This idea resonates deeply with anyone striving for growth in their life. To illustrate this, let’s consider the journey of an aspiring artist who faces constant criticism and self-doubt. Despite the hurdles, the artist must practice holding ground by staying true to their vision and passion for art.Initially, the artist may encounter negative feedback from peers or mentors who question their style or choice of subject matter. At this point, the temptation to conform to others’ expectations can be overwhelming. However, holding ground means resisting this pressure and believing in one’s unique perspective. It requires a strong sense of self-awareness and confidence in one’s abilities.As the artist continues to create, they may experience moments of self-doubt. Perhaps they compare themselves to more successful artists and feel inadequate. Here again, holding ground plays a crucial role. Instead of succumbing to feelings of inferiority, the artist must remind themselves of their passion and the reasons they chose this path. They should reflect on their progress and the joy that creating brings them, reinforcing their commitment to their craft.Moreover, holding ground is not solely about individual perseverance; it also involves standing firm in one’s values when faced with societal pressures. Consider an environmental activist who advocates for sustainable practices. In a world dominated by consumerism and instant gratification, it can be challenging to promote conservation. However, holding ground means consistently educating others about the importance of protecting the environment, even when it feels like an uphill battle.This activist might encounter skepticism or hostility from those who prioritize convenience over sustainability. Yet, by holding ground, they inspire others to reconsider their choices and embrace a more eco-friendly lifestyle. Their steadfastness can spark change within their community, demonstrating how powerful it is to remain committed to one’s principles.Additionally, holding ground can manifest in various aspects of life, including relationships and career choices. For instance, an employee who believes in ethical business practices may find themselves at odds with a company culture that prioritizes profit over integrity. In such situations, holding ground involves advocating for ethical standards, even if it means facing backlash or risking their job.In conclusion, the practice of holding ground is essential for anyone on the path of self-discovery and growth. It empowers individuals to stay true to their beliefs, values, and passions despite external pressures. Whether it’s an artist pursuing their dream, an activist fighting for a cause, or an employee standing up for what is right, holding ground is a testament to resilience and conviction. Ultimately, those who master this skill will not only navigate challenges more effectively but also inspire others to do the same, creating a ripple effect of positive change in the world.
